This story is about Marguerite, an accomplished pianist who lost her ability to play the piano after suffering a paralytic stroke that almost took her life. She was devastated and deeply concerned about her three young children and their care, especially after she found that her condition was permanent. When she consulted her former piano teacher, he suggested she return to teaching piano to children, using only one hand. For the next twenty-five years, her life was full of joy until thorns flooded her life with many orthopedic surgeries needed that eventually left her wheelchair bound, unable to stand or walk at all. Pain, depression, and hopelessness took over; this time, she called out to her Savior, Jesus, to help her. Her faith took deep roots and her life took on a whole new meaning. With God's help, she received the strength to live a victorious life!
